Bridge Snapshot: EAST 7TH STREET

The EAST 7TH STREET bridge in Montezuma, Colorado carries EAST 7TH STREET over UNNAMED DRAINAGE. It was built in 2005, making it 21 years old today. The structure is built primarily of concrete and spans 1 section, stretching 14.6 meters (48 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 2,740 vehicles, placing it in the moderately-trafficked tier of Colorado bridges. It is owned and maintained by City/Municipal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show superstructure at 6/9, substructure at 7/9. The weakest component sits in fair condition. All reported major components score above the Poor range. Its NBI inventory load rating is 32.7 metric tons.

How to read this record

This page shows what the last federal inspection recorded, not whether EAST 7TH STREET is safe to cross today. Here is how to use it.

  • NBI condition ratings reflect the latest record in this annual dataset, not a live status. Current routine inspection intervals are risk-based.

Condition codes come straight from the FHWA National Bridge Inventory and are not a real-time safety judgment. Only the owning agency, a state DOT, county, or other owner, can post, restrict, or close a bridge.
